A Nest for the Newlyweds
by Marge Simon
Frederick and Sarah Whitfield, newlyweds, stood holding hands. Before them was a spacious area in a run-down old building.
“It was once a gym, and this was the indoor pool. As you can tell, it survived the bombing, but barely. You see,” said Frederick, “it’s just as I told you, love! Suits our needs perfectly, yes?”
“You know, it does have a certain something about it. But the roof –”
“Oh, we can get that fixed,” said Frederick.
“And all those windows, most of them missing glass –?”
“No problem, we can replace the old glass with opaque. We were going to do that anyway, no matter what we chose.”
“For privacy, of course,” Sarah nodded.
“I’m a bit concerned about how much we’ll need to fill the pool area, but we’ll cross that bridge when we come to it.”
Six months later…
“Done, beautiful! That thing took seventeen drums of acid to fill it, a bit more than the estimate, though,” said Frederick.
“And a pretty penny it was. But our victims’ disposal system is in place.” Sarah gave Fred’s hand a squeeze. No more worries about Scotland Yard finding bodies buried in the basement.”
“Right. We have so much to look forward to, my dearest. What fun!”
They sealed it with a kiss.
